What to check before for pre-war buildings near the Q24 bus in East New York

  • Confirm the commute match: check your exact stop and walking time to the Q24 route before signing a lease.
  • Treat “pre-war” as a building-age label, not a condition guarantee. Ask about current systems, pest control history, and recent repairs.
  • Use the Openigloo reviews from rated buildings to compare maintenance patterns and responsiveness across similar buildings.
  • Before applying, verify key move-in costs beyond rent (deposit, fees, and any move-in paperwork requirements) and who pays utilities.
  • If a building is marketed as having units available, still confirm lease start date, renewal expectations, and any restrictions tied to the apartment.
